About SynTest

SynTest Technologies, Inc. develops and markets advanced Design For Test (DFT DFT - discrete Fourier transform ) and Design For Debug/Diagnosis (DFD DFD - Data Flow Diagram ) tools to semiconductor companies, ASIC (Application Specific Integrated Circuit) Pronounced "a-sick." A chip that is custom designed for a specific application rather than a general-purpose chip such as a microprocessor.  designers and test groups throughout the world. Headquartered in Sunnyvale, California Sunnyvale ([sʌniveil]) is a city in Santa Clara County, California, United States. It is one of the major cities that make up the Silicon Valley. As of the 2000 census, the city population was 131,760. , the company has offices in Taiwan, Korea and Japan. The company's products improve an electronic design's testability and fault coverage, and result in reduced defect levels, reduced costly tester time, and reduced slippage in time-to-market.
